## Description

**About the Role**

We are looking for a Senior AI Engineer to design, build, and operate production-grade Generative AI solutions on the Microsoft Azure AI ecosystem. You will be the technical anchor for our GenAI initiatives, owning the end-to-end lifecycle: from foundation model selection and prompt/RAG architecture through deployment, MLOps, security hardening, and continuous evaluation. This is a hands-on senior role. You will set technical direction, mentor engineers, and work directly with product, data, security, and platform teams to move AI use cases from prototype to reliable, governed, cost-efficient services.

**What You Will do**

**GenAI solution design and delivery**

• Architect and build LLM-powered applications (RAG, agents, copilots, document intelligence, content understanding, conversational systems) using Azure AI Foundry, Azure OpenAI, and the broader Azure AI and data portfolio

. • Design retrieval pipelines with Azure AI Search (vector, hybrid, and semantic ranking), including chunking, embedding, indexing, and relevance tuning strategies.

• Evaluate, fine-tune, and deploy foundation and open-source models (e.g., GPT, Phi, Llama, Mistral, Kimi, GLM) through Azure AI Foundry model catalog and Azure Machine Learning.

• Implement prompt engineering, orchestration frameworks (Semantic Kernel, LangChain, Prompt Flow, or equivalent), and structured evaluation of model quality, groundedness, and safety.

**Platform, MLOps, and productionization**

• Build and maintain MLOps/LLMOps pipelines on Azure ML, Github Enterprise: experiment tracking, model registry, CI/CD for models and prompts, automated evaluation, monitoring, and drift/cost management.

• Expose AI capabilities as scalable microservices (Azure Kubernetes Service, Azure Container Apps, Azure Functions, API Management), with attention to latency, throughput, resilience, and cost.

• Establish observability for AI systems: tracing, token/cost telemetry, quality metrics, and feedback loops.

**AI security and governance**

• Apply Responsible AI and AI security practices: content safety filters, prompt-injection and jailbreak mitigation, data-leakage controls, PII handling, and red-teaming.

• Implement secure architectures using Azure identity (Entra ID, managed identities), private endpoints, Key Vault, network isolation, and data residency controls.

• Contribute to AI governance standards, model risk documentation, and compliance requirements.

**Technical leadership**

• Define reference architectures, coding standards, and reusable components for GenAI workloads.

• Mentor and review the work of other engineers; lead design discussions and technical decision-making.

• Partner with stakeholders to translate business problems into feasible, measurable AI solutions and communicate trade-offs clearly.

• Stay current with the rapidly evolving model and tooling landscape and bring practical recommendations to the team.

## Requirements

**Required Qualifications**

• 8–10+ years of overall experience in AI, machine learning, and data engineering, with a strong track record of delivering production systems.

• Minimum 2–3 years of hands-on experience with Azure AI Foundry (formerly Azure AI Studio) and Azure OpenAI Service, including deploying and operating GenAI applications in production.

• Deep expertise across the Azure AI ecosystem: Azure Machine Learning, Azure AI Search, Azure AI Services (Document Intelligence, Language, Speech, Vision), Fabric and Azure AI Content Safety.

• Strong understanding of LLMs and foundation models: architectures, tokenization, context management, embeddings, fine-tuning (LoRA/PEFT), quantization, and evaluation methods.

• Practical experience with open-source models and frameworks (Hugging Face, Llama, Mistral, Phi, vLLM/ONNX Runtime or similar serving stacks).

• Proven MLOps/LLMOps experience: CI/CD, model versioning, automated testing and evaluation, monitoring, and rollback strategies.

• Experience designing and building microservices and APIs (containers, Kubernetes, REST/gRPC, event-driven patterns) with Azure DevOps or GitHub Actions.

• Demonstrated knowledge of AI security and Responsible AI: threat modeling for LLM applications (OWASP Top 10 for LLMs), data protection, access control, and safety guardrails.

• Working experience with at least one other cloud provider (AWS or GCP) and their AI/ML services (e.g., Amazon Bedrock, SageMaker, Vertex AI).

• Expert-level Python; solid software engineering fundamentals (testing, code review, design patterns, performance optimization).

• Strong data foundations: SQL, data pipelines, data modeling, and familiarity with Azure data services (Data Factory, Databricks, Synapse, Fabric, Cosmos DB, or equivalent).

• Excellent communication skills with the ability to explain complex AI concepts to technical and non-technical audiences.

**Preferred Qualifications**

• Microsoft certifications: AI-102 (Azure AI Engineer Associate), DP-100 (Azure Data Scientist Associate), or AZ-305.

• Experience with agentic AI patterns, multi-agent orchestration, and tool/function calling (Azure AI Agent Service, Semantic Kernel agents, AutoGen, or similar).

• Experience with vector databases beyond Azure AI Search (e.g., Cosmos DB vector search, PostgreSQL pgvector, Pinecone, Weaviate).

• Background in NLP, computer vision, or speech systems prior to the GenAI era.

• Experience with model evaluation and observability tooling (Azure AI evaluation SDK, Prompt Flow evaluations, Langfuse, MLflow, Weights & Biases).

• Familiarity with regulatory and compliance frameworks relevant to AI (GDPR, ISO/IEC 42001, NIST AI RMF, EU AI Act, or regional data protection regulations).

• Experience operating in regulated industries (financial services, healthcare, government) or large-enterprise environments.
